    Hey all. My computer keeps shutting down without warning. I am running on Windows Xp Proffesional build 2600 version 2002. I dont think its a hardware issue because i am getting the following error when my PC boots back up:

    the system has recovered from a serious error

    the following files reported this error:
    C:\WINDOWS\Minidump\Mini110104-06.dmp
    C:\DOCUME~1\Joe\LOCALS~1\Temp\WER2.tmp.dir00\sysdata.xml

    error signature:
    BCCode : d1 BCP1 : 00000009 BCP2 : 00000002 BCP3 : 00000000
    BCP4 : 00000009 OSVer : 5_1_2600 SP : 0_0 Product : 256_1

    Is it possible this has something to do with memory?
    Completed a virus scan. Results turned up nothing
    please help! :(

    I very much doubt it's a hard drive problem. Have you looked in Event Viewer as surferdude2 suggested?

    If you have not already done so .....

    Right click My Computer > Properties > Advanced > Startup and Recovery > Settings > System Failure and untick Automatically Restart. This will give show the BSOD (Blue Screen of Death) with details of the failure which you can post here.

    - two possibilities here - roll back the driver to the original one - unless this is a new card OR uninstall the card in Device Manager and reboot. Good idea to remove all card software through Add/Remove Programs too. Reboot and let Windows find the card, then reinstall the software. If this doesn't solve your problem posy back and we'll look elsewhere.
